2737-2754 of 18,722 vehicles
£19,765
£19,635
£16,595
£14,935
£15,395
£15,335
£17,535
£17,895
£16,095
£55,990
£22,995
£20,695
£59,989
£31,500
£35,650
£37,350
£39,190